What is Double Glazing?
Double glazing is a kind of insulation that includes 2 panes of glass separated by a space, usually filled with air or inert gas. This configuration serves a main function: to reduce heat transfer between the exterior and interior of a structure. As an outcome, double-glazed windows assist maintain warmth during winter and keep areas cooler throughout summertime.

Glass Types
The effectiveness of double glazing is mainly affected by the kind of glass utilized. Below are the typical types of glass utilized in double glazing:
Glass TypeDescriptionBenefitsDownsidesDrift GlassFundamental glass, normally used in standard applications.AffordableLess insulation compared to Low-E glass.Low-Emissivity (Low-E)Glass coated with a thin metallic layer to reflect heat.Outstanding insulation, preserves natural light.Higher initial expense.Tempered GlassHeat-treated glass that is more powerful and more secure.More durable, resistant to impact.Can be more pricey due to processing.Laminated GlassGlass layers bonded with a plastic interlayer.Offers security and UV protection.Heavier and more expensive alternatives.2. Spacer Bars
Spacer bars are the products that separate the 2 panes of glass in a double-glazed system. Numerous materials can be used for this function:
Spacer Bar MaterialDescriptionBenefitsDownsidesAluminiumLightweight and stiff however conductive.Long lasting and economical.Can result in condensation due to heat transfer.PVC-UA plastic alternative, less conductive compared to aluminum.Great thermal performance.Might not be as durable as aluminum.Warm Edge TechnologyFrequently consists of a composite material.Decreases thermal bridging, enhancing efficiency.Normally more costly.3. Gas Fills
The space in between the panes of glass can be filled with air or specific gases to boost insulation.
Gas TypeDescriptionBenefitsDrawbacksAirRegular air without any unique residential or commercial properties.Economical and enough for many applications.Lower insulation than gas-filled systems.ArgonInert gas that is denser than air.Exceptional thermal insulation.More pricey than air however often warranted.KryptonHeavier and more effective than argon.Best insulation of the gas choices.Much higher cost and needs specialized techniques.Factors Influencing the Choice of Double Glazing Materials

Q: How long do double-glazed windows last?
A: Typically, double-glazed windows can last anywhere from 20 to 35 years, depending on the quality of materials and installation.
Q: Can I replace simply one pane of a double-glazed system?
A: It is generally recommended to replace the whole double-glazed system for optimum efficiency, as replacing just one pane can cause mismatching insulation homes.
Q: Are double-glazed units more costly than single glazing?
A: Yes, double-glazed units typically have a greater upfront expense due to innovative products and building, but they typically spend for themselves through energy savings.
Q: Will double glazing lower noise contamination?
A: Yes, double-glazing effectively minimizes outside noise, making your living environment more serene.
